Problem/Issue: Some UPS devices with the SMX and SMC prefix, e.g. SMX3000LVNC, SMX3000HVNC, SMC1500I, do not allow the values for High and Low Transfer Values to be edited in the UPS Settings screen. Description This issue is specific to these UPS devices. When the values are edited and saved, the new values do not persist and instead, the previous values remain.

To work around this, you can change these values using a Network Management 2 (NMC2) card. Problem/Issue: Some UPS devices with the RT prefix, e.g. RT 2200 XL, RT 1000 XL, display some events in the Event Configuration screen that are not supported by these models. For example: AVR Boost Enabled, AVR Trim Enabled, AVR Boost Not Enabled, AVR Trim Not Enabled, Extended Undervoltage, Extended Overvoltage, Frequent Undervoltage, and Frequent Overvoltage. Description This issue is specific to these UPS devices and does not affect any functionality. Description This issue is specific to the SHA1 and AES-256 Ex combination only. Combinations using SHA-1 and AES-192 or AES-256 allow successful connection.

Problem/Issue: On some UPS devices with the SUA prefix, e.g. SUA3000RM, the 'Replace Battery' event is logged in the Event Log and the UPS status changes to 'Replace Battery' in the Battery Management page after a 'Self Test Failed' event. Description This issue is specific to this UPS model. Problem/Issue: On Type B UPS devices, except models with the SRC prefix, e.g. SRC1K1, SRC2KI, SRC1K1-IN, and SRC1KUXI, a self test can be initiated if the battery percentage is below 70%.

Description This issue is specific to Type B UPS devices. Visit Knowledge Base article on the to find out more about UPS model types. Problem/Issue: Bypass-related events are not shown in the Event Configuration screen for some UPS devices with the SRC prefix and UXI postfix, e.g. SRC2KUXI, SRC2000UXI, SRC3000UXI. Description This issue is specific to these UPS models only.
